How to Use MAUS Old Papers for Preparation

Choose one MAUS course at a time and solve its papers separately. This makes it easier to compare your performance across sessions and prevents topics from different subjects being mixed during revision.

Old question papers are best used as practice material. They can highlight earlier question styles and recurring areas of study, while your main preparation should remain based on the current IGNOU course material.
